The following services are provided at the UNITE HERE Health Center Dental Office.
Routine exams are important for maintaining your oral health.
Our hygienists perform cleanings to remove plaque, stains, and tartar to keep your mouth healthy.
We use a state-of-the-art digital x-ray system to see inside a tooth, beneath the gums and other areas not visible to the naked eye.
The dentist may recommend a filling to restore a tooth damaged by decay back to its normal function and shape.
The crown itself is designed to save what is left of a tooth and prevent further degradation.
A bridge or partial is typically used to fill in gaps left by missing teeth.
If a tooth has been deemed unsalvageable, our dentist will remove the tooth and discuss options for prosthetic replacements, such as implants, bridges, and removable partial dentures.
Our dentist may recommend a root canal in an attempt to repair and save a badly damaged or infected tooth.
The goal of an oral cancer screening is to identify mouth cancer early, when there is a greater chance for a cure.
Includes Invisalign as well as metal brackets and wires depending on the needs of the patient.
Our dentists have expertise providing preventative care and common dental procedures to children.

Our technology
DYNTL is well-appointed with the latest equipment and technological advancements in modern dentistry. With the use of advanced technology, most patients can expect more predictable treatment outcomes while enjoying a more comfortable experience.
The Oral ID device, an early oral cancer detection tool, uses Fluorescence Technology to detect pre-cancer and cancer abnormalities. Early detection is crucial in combating oral cancer.
High-resolution digital intra-oral cameras help the dental team identify and track issues that may otherwise go undetected. It allows patients to see what we see and better understand any current or developing concerns.
Digital radiography provides dentists with a detailed view of the teeth, bone, and soft tissue structures, eliminating the need for traditional film development. This technology delivers quicker, more accurate images, enhancing diagnostic capabilities while reducing radiation exposure.
Cutting edge 3D X-ray technology provides the most comprehensive view of a patient’s dentition and supporting bone and soft tissue structures. This is especially important when placing dental implants.
